Gujarat
Overview
Gujarat is a vibrant state in West India, covering 196,024 square kilometres. It is famous for its deserts, wildlife sanctuaries, historic forts, and rich culture. Tourists visit the Rann of Kutch, which hosts the annual Rann Utsav and attracts visitors from across India and the world.
The state has significant heritage sites like Gir National Park, home to the Asiatic lion, and ancient temples in Somnath and Dwarka. Cities such as Ahmedabad, Surat, and Vadodara showcase a blend of modern infrastructure and historical charm. Gujarat is also known for its textiles, handicrafts, and local cuisine, which reflect the culture of the region.
